Cam Snow replied to Shiva Padmanaban's discussion Design and Fabrication of a Quadcopter
"To your points #1 and #3: 1. 30 minutes flight time is a lot for any multi/heli... you'll see a lot of people on here are getting 7-12 minutes.  If you want more flight time try getting the highest mAh battery that you can find...…"
